On Sun, 27 Jan 2002, G. Major wrote: > > Unfortunately, something seems to have gotten broken. When I boot, I do not > get a login prompt. The screen is all gray and the cursor works but no login > prompt. I have been attempting to debug it with no success. It seems to be a > "kdm" problem of some sort but I have no idea what the problem is or how to > fix it. >
Curiously, this is the behaviour that I was after for my particular application. However, I looked through the notes I sent you and I didn't send you the specifics for shutting off the xdm query, so I don't think the error is there. What I would do is restart xdm on the server machine, reboot your client, then check the X11 logs on the server. Be sure the line to start the xserver has -query <xdmserver> as an argument. In rc.local there should be a line that looks like: echo "/usr/X11R6/bin/${XBINARY} ${ACC_CTRL} -query ${XDM_SERVER}" >/tmp/start_ws Hope this helps. -don _____________________________________________________________________ Ltsp-discuss mailing list.
